Summary
A vulnerability was found in Google Android. It has been declared as problematic. The affected element is the function mon_smc_load_sp of the file gs101-sc/plat/samsung/exynos/soc/exynos9845/smc_booting.S of the component TEE. Such manipulation leads to information disclosure.
This vulnerability is listed as CVE-2021-39647. The attack must be carried out locally. There is no available exploit.
It is advisable to implement a patch to correct this issue.
Details
A vulnerability was found in Google Android (Smartphone Operating System) (version now known) and classified as problematic. Affected by this issue is the function mon_smc_load_sp of the file gs101-sc/plat/samsung/exynos/soc/exynos9845/smc_booting.S of the component TEE. The manipulation with an unknown input leads to a information disclosure vulnerability. Using CWE to declare the problem leads to CWE-200. The product exposes sensitive information to an actor that is not explicitly authorized to have access to that information. Impacted is confidentiality.
The weakness was presented 12/16/2021 as A-198713939. The advisory is shared for download at source.android.com. This vulnerability is handled as CVE-2021-39647 since 08/23/2021. There are known technical details, but no exploit is available. The MITRE ATT&CK project declares the attack technique as T1592.
Applying a patch is able to eliminate this problem.
